erudolph Posted August 3, 2024 Share #85 Â Posted August 3, 2024 If you reset the #, the first time it will create a folder Leica100 and the first exposure will be L100000. Â If you reset again, it will create a second folder Leica101 with next exposure being L1010000. Â Etcetera. Â So, say, if yr last exposure before firmware update was L101xxxx, you could reset until you got to Leica102 folder, and the next exposure would be a higher number than the last exposure before firmware update. Â I hope this makes sense. 2 Link to post Share on other sites More sharing options...
